What happens when I cancel my membership?
When you cancel your membership, your profile will be removed from the Fresh Starts Expert Guide immediately. The good news is, if you decide to return, you can reactivate at any time and your profile will be preserved. You’ll continue to have access to your dashboard until your membership end date, but community events and referrals will no longer be available to you.
Any podcast recordings you’ve scheduled will be cancelled, and if you have podcasts currently in production, they will not be pushed live. Any content you’ve contributed—any previously shared articles, events, freebies, groups, or classes—will remain published for now, but may be removed at any time after cancellation. Any co-branded or jointly run workshops will also be cancelled.
Is there a required membership commitment for Experts in the Fresh Starts Registry Expert Guide?
We don’t require a long-term membership commitment—but we highly encourage experts to plan to stay in the Expert Guide for at least 6 months. Building trust with our audience takes time, especially because many people going through life transitions need to see a familiar, consistent presence before they feel ready to reach out. Remaining in the guide for a longer period helps you establish credibility and gives people the chance to truly get to know you. While you’re free to come and go as needed, we’ve found that experts who stay longer tend to build stronger connections and receive more referrals.
